HTML 網頁模板源代碼網頁設計制作的基石,在當今數字化時代,網頁成為了人們獲取信息、進行交流和開展業務的重要窗口。而 HTML(超文本標記語言)網頁模板源代碼則是構建這些網頁的基礎框架,它猶如一座大廈的藍圖,決定了網頁的結構、布局和基本功能。本文將深入探討 HTML 網頁模板源代碼在網頁設計制作中的關鍵作用、常見的結構與元素,以及如何利用它來創建具有吸引力和實用性的網頁。
一、HTML 網頁模板源代碼的重要性
HTML 是網頁開發的核心語言之一,它通過一系列的標簽來描述網頁的內容和結構。一個精心設計的 HTML 網頁模板源代碼能夠帶來諸多好處:
一致性與可維護性:模板為整個網站提供了統一的結構和樣式基礎。當需要對網站進行全局修改時,例如調整導航欄樣式或更新頁腳信息,只需在模板中進行一次更改,所有基于該模板的頁面都會相應更新,大大提高了維護效率,確保了網站風格的一致性。
提高開發效率:對于大型網站項目,無需從零開始編寫每個頁面的 HTML 代碼。開發人員可以基于模板快速創建新頁面,專注于頁面特定內容的填充,減少了重復勞動,加快了項目開發進度。
搜索引擎優化(SEO)友好:合理組織的 HTML 結構有助于搜索引擎爬蟲理解網頁內容。通過正確使用標題標簽(如<h1>、<h2>等)、語義化標簽(如<article>、<section>等),可以提高網頁在搜索引擎結果頁面中的排名,增加網站的流量和曝光度。
二、HTML 網頁模板的基本結構
一個典型的 HTML 網頁模板由以下幾個主要部分構成:
文檔類型聲明(DOCTYPE):位于 HTML 文檔的開頭,用于告知瀏覽器該文檔遵循的 HTML 版本標準。例如,<!DOCTYPE html>表示使用 HTML5 標準。這是確保瀏覽器正確解析頁面的重要前提。
<html>標簽:是整個 HTML 文檔的根元素,所有其他元素都嵌套在它內部。它包含兩個主要子元素:<head>和<body>。
<head>部分:主要用于存放關于網頁的元信息,這些信息不會直接顯示在頁面內容中,但對瀏覽器和搜索引擎有著重要作用。常見的元素包括:
<title>標簽:定義網頁的標題,顯示在瀏覽器的標題欄或標簽頁上,也是搜索引擎結果中顯示的主要標題信息,對用戶識別頁面內容和搜索引擎排名都有重要影響。例如:<title>我的網頁標題</title>。
<meta>標簽:用于提供各種元數據,如字符編碼設置(<meta charset=”UTF-8″>確保頁面能正確顯示各種字符)、頁面描述(<meta name=”description” content=”這是關于網頁的簡要描述”>用于搜索引擎展示頁面摘要)、關鍵詞設置(<meta name=”keywords” content=”關鍵詞 1,關鍵詞 2,關鍵詞 3″>輔助搜索引擎索引頁面)等。
<link>標簽:用于引入外部資源,如樣式表文件(.css),以實現網頁的樣式美化。例如:<link rel=”stylesheet” href=”styles.css”>將名為styles.css的樣式表與當前頁面關聯起來。
<script>標簽:可用于引入外部 JavaScript 文件或直接在頁面中嵌入 JavaScript 代碼,實現網頁的動態交互功能。例如:<script src=”script.js”></script>引入script.js腳本文件。
<body>部分:這是網頁實際內容的展示區域,用戶在瀏覽器中看到的文本、圖片、鏈接、表單等所有可見元素都包含在<body>標簽內。例如:
<body>
<h1>歡迎來到我的網頁</h1>
<p>這是一段網頁內容的示例。</p>
<img src=”image.jpg” alt=”示例圖片”>
<a href=”#”>這是一個鏈接</a>
</body>
三、HTML 網頁模板中的常見元素
除了上述基本結構元素外,HTML 還提供了豐富多樣的標簽用于構建網頁內容:
標題標簽(<h1> – <h6>):用于定義不同級別的標題,<h1>表示最重要的標題,通常用于頁面的主標題,隨著數字增大,標題級別逐漸降低,語義重要性也相應減弱。例如:
<h1>一級標題</h1>
<h2>二級標題</h2>
<h3>三級標題</h3>
段落標簽(<p>):用于包裹一段文本內容,使文本在頁面中以段落形式呈現,瀏覽器會自動在段落之間添加適當的間距。例如:<p>這是一個段落的文本內容。</p>
鏈接標簽(<a>):創建超鏈接,通過href屬性指定鏈接的目標地址,可以是其他網頁、文件或頁面內的錨點。例如:<a href=”https://www.example.com”>點擊跳轉到示例網站</a>
圖像標簽(<img>):用于在網頁中插入圖片,通過src屬性指定圖片的文件路徑,alt屬性提供圖片的替代文本,當圖片無法顯示時,替代文本會顯示出來,同時也有助于搜索引擎理解圖片內容。例如:<img src=”logo.png” alt=”網站 logo”>
列表標簽:
無序列表(<ul>):用于創建無序列表,每個列表項使用<li>標簽包裹。例如:
<ul>
<li>列表項 1</li>
<li>列表項 2</li>
<li>列表項 3</li>
</ul>
有序列表(<ol>):創建有序列表,同樣每個列表項用<li>標簽。例如:
<ol>
<li>第一項</li>
<li>第二項</li>
<li>第三項</li>
</ol>
表格標簽(<table>):用于創建表格,由<tr>(表格行)、<td>(表格單元格)等標簽組合而成。例如:
<table>
<tr>
<td>姓名</td>
<td>年齡</td>
</tr>
<tr>
<td>張三</td>
<td>25</td>
</tr>
</table>
表單標簽(<form>):用于創建用戶交互的表單,如登錄表單、注冊表單等。表單中包含各種輸入元素,如<input>(文本框、密碼框、單選按鈕、復選框等)、<textarea>(多行文本輸入框)、<select>(下拉列表)等,并通過action屬性指定表單提交的目標地址,method屬性確定提交方式(如GET或POST)。例如:
<form action=”submit.php” method=”POST”>
<label for=”username”>用戶名:</label><input type=”text” id=”username” name=”username”><br>
<label for=”password”>密碼:</label><input type=”password” id=”password” name=”password”><br>
<input type=”submit” value=”提交”>
</form>
四、利用 HTML 網頁模板源代碼創建網頁的步驟
以下是一個簡單的利用 HTML 網頁模板源代碼創建網頁的基本流程:
規劃網頁結構與內容:在開始編寫代碼之前,明確網頁的目標、布局和所需展示的內容。確定頁面的主要板塊,如頭部導航、主體內容、側邊欄、頁腳等,以及每個板塊中具體包含的元素,如標題、文本、圖片、鏈接等。
搭建 HTML 基本框架:按照上述介紹的 HTML 網頁模板基本結構,創建DOCTYPE聲明、<html>、<head>和<body>標簽,并在<head>部分設置好頁面標題、元信息以及引入所需的外部資源(樣式表和腳本文件)。
填充主體內容:在<body>標簽內,根據規劃逐步添加各種 HTML 元素來構建頁面內容。使用標題標簽組織內容層次,段落標簽添加文本說明,鏈接標簽創建導航和相關鏈接,圖像標簽插入圖片,根據需要使用列表、表格或表單等元素來豐富頁面功能和展示效果。
樣式設計與美化(結合 CSS):雖然 HTML 主要負責網頁結構,但樣式設計對于提升用戶體驗至關重要。通過編寫 CSS 樣式表文件,并在 HTML 模板的<head>部分使用<link>標簽引入該樣式表,對網頁中的元素進行樣式定義,包括字體、顏色、背景、布局、間距等方面的美化,使網頁呈現出專業、美觀的視覺效果。
添加交互功能(結合 JavaScript):若網頁需要實現動態交互功能,如點擊按鈕顯示隱藏內容、表單驗證、頁面元素動畫效果等,可以編寫 JavaScript 代碼。將 JavaScript 代碼保存為單獨的文件,并在 HTML 模板的<head>或<body>部分使用<script>標簽引入,或者直接在<script>標簽內嵌入代碼,根據用戶操作和業務邏輯來實現網頁的交互性增強。
測試與優化:在完成網頁的基本制作后,在不同的瀏覽器(如 Chrome、Firefox、Safari 等)和設備(桌面電腦、平板電腦、手機等)上進行測試,檢查頁面布局是否正常、元素是否顯示正確、鏈接是否有效、表單是否能正常提交等。根據測試結果,對代碼進行優化和調整,修復出現的兼容性問題和錯誤,確保網頁在各種環境下都能正常運行并提供良好的用戶體驗。
總之,HTML 網頁模板源代碼是網頁設計制作的基礎和核心。掌握 HTML 網頁模板的結構、元素和創建流程,能夠為開發出高質量、功能豐富且用戶友好的網頁奠定堅實的基礎。無論是對于專業的網頁開發者還是對網頁制作感興趣的初學者,深入理解和熟練運用 HTML 網頁模板源代碼都是邁向成功網頁設計的重要一步。隨著技術的不斷發展,HTML 也在持續演進,不斷學習和探索新的特性和最佳實踐,將有助于在網頁設計領域保持競爭力并創造出更加出色的網頁作品。